Story summary
- Schumer says a government shutdown can be avoided if Republicans negotiate, noting the White House accepted a meeting with Senate Majority Leader John Thune.
- He hopes for productive talks, contrasting them with past partisan approaches.
- He cites health-care concerns—rising premiums and rural hospital closures—and notes the Senate requires 60 votes to pass funding, with Republicans holding 53 seats.
